About Birth Control
Birth control refers to the interception of a female egg and a male sperm so that embryo implantation, resulting in pregnancy, does not occur. Birth control has been practiced for thousands of years, and there are various methods which have evolved, including birth control pills, patches, and shots, as well as condoms, diaphragms, and birth control rings. Methods that don't require additional contraception include early withdrawal and abstinence.
About Planned Parenthood
Planned Parenthood (PP) is a national reproductive and sexual health care organization with more than 800 health centers across the nation. It prides itself on being "the nation's leading sexual and reproductive health care advocate and provider." Some services offered at PP include sexual health education, providing contraceptive and emergency contraceptive, prenatal care, and STD testing/treatment. Some PP clinics provide surgical/medical abortions.
